Arbitrary file upload in Grand Vice Info Co. Webopac7
CVE-2021-42839
Grand Vice info Co. webopac7 file upload function fails to filter special characters. While logging in with general user’s permission, remote attackers can upload malicious script and execute arbitrary code to control the system or interru…
Vulnerability class: Unrestricted File Upload
EPSS: 0.024 (81.6th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.
CVSS v3 metric
CVSS v3 base score 8.8 (High).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H.
Affected products
- Grand Vice Info Co. Webopac7 — versions 7.1.20160701, 1.8.20160701
- Vice Webopac — versions 1.8.20160701, 7.1.20160701
